The Ford A-62, A-64, and A-66 Wheel Loaders are heavy-duty articulated loaders built for construction, quarry, and industrial applications. These machines combine robust diesel engines with powerful hydraulics, delivering high breakout force, stable loader performance, and dependable operation in demanding environments. With horsepower ratings ranging from 103 hp (A-62) to 160 hp (A-66), this series provides a versatile lineup to match different job site requirements.
The Ford A-62 is equipped with a 4.4L 4-cylinder diesel producing approximately 103 hp, with an operating weight between 16,000β19,700 lbs and a wheelbase of 103 inches. The A-64 increases capacity to around 125 hp with additional hydraulic strength and weight, making it ideal for mid-range loader applications. The A-66, the largest in the lineup, is powered by a 6.6L 6-cylinder diesel rated at 160 hp, with operating weights up to 29,000 lbs and a wheelbase of 111 inches, offering maximum lift and breakout capacity for heavy-duty loading and material handling tasks.
The workshop repair manual provides full service coverage for these models across two volumes. Major sections include the engine system, fuel and electrical systems, transmission, axles, brakes, and drive shafts, along with wheels and tires. Additional coverage includes steering, hydraulics, loader frame and linkage, operatorβs platform and sheet metal, as well as heating and air conditioning systems. It also provides detailed procedures for engine-transmission removal, component overhauls, and reference information. Step-by-step troubleshooting, lubrication guides, wiring diagrams, and hydraulic schematics ensure accurate diagnostics and efficient servicing.
